We check them 3 times every 8 hour shift. Once at the start at 7am, once before noon, and once before report at 3pm. But truth be told, I assess them more frequently than that.

I work in the NICU and we do Q2 vent checks. If the infant is started on nitric, then we do vitals Q1 for the first 24 hours.

I mentioned before that we do Q2 vent checks. Just thought I would mention that RTs do Q4 and Nursing does the other Q4. So they end up getting checked Q2. I know a lot of RTs don't like when Nurses mess with their vents, so I am just curious to know how everyone feels about that. Anyone else do this as well???

The nurses where I work are not allowed to touch the vents other than to push the 100% button for suctioning. The settings are always left on the screen so they have no real need to in order to chart the settings. Works out for the best in my opinion. I have the need to chart vitals but I don't need to mess with their monitors in order to do so, to that end, they don't need to mess with my vent Smile
